Akshay Kumar, who has about five films lined up for theatrical release, asks the audience to come out and watch the films in the theatres.
Talking to a news portal, the ‘Khiladi’ star said that it is a good feeling to have four to five releases in a year again. Things are getting back to normal and he hopes that it stays that way. According to the actor, they have been waiting behind the scenes with bated breath for the right time to showcase and unleash the entertainment to the audiences for the past year-and-a-half.
Elaborating further, Akshay added that the industry is being hopeful like they were before the second wave and keeping their fingers very tightly crossed that the worst is over. They are just going with the flow. According to him, it has been a very tough year-and-a-half for the entire industry with everyone bleeding money but things are finally looking up with the reopening of cinemas in Maharashtra. He hopes that the audiences have missed watching them as much as they have missed them.
Akshay Kumar has about five movies that are all set to hit the theatres in the next couple of months and it includes, ‘Sooryavanshi’, ‘Prithviraj’, ‘Bachchan Pandey’, ‘RakshaBandhan’ and ‘Ram Setu’. There’s also ‘Oh My God’ and ‘Atrangi Re’, both of which are likely to release sometime next year.
He was last seen in ‘Bell Bottom’ which also had a theatre release. However, it was not released in Maharashtra as the cinema halls remained closed.
